Honda Civic (2009) vs. Jeep Wrangler (2011) Specs

How powerful is the engine? How much room is in the back seat? Get the 2009 Honda Civic and 2011 Jeep Wrangler specs.

2009 Honda Civic and 2011 Jeep Wrangler Specifications

Model Year 2009 2011  
Model Honda Civic Jeep Wrangler  
Engine  
Transmission  
Drivetrain  
Body 4dr Sedan 4dr SUV  
      Difference
Wheelbase 106.3 in 116.0 in -9.7 in
Length 176.7 in 184.4 in -7.7 in
Width 69.0 in 73.9 in -4.9 in
Height 56.5 in 72.3 in -15.8 in
Curb Weight 2628 lb. 4180 lb. -1552 lb.
Fuel Capacity 13.2 gal. 21.6 gal. -8.4 gal.
Headroom, Row 1 39.4 in 41.3 in -1.9 in
Shoulder Room, Row 1 53.7 in 55.8 in -2.1 in
Hip Room, Row 1 51.9 in 55.6 in -3.7 in
Legroom, Row 1 42.2 in 41.0 in 1.2 in
Headroom, Row 2 37.4 in 40.3 in -2.9 in
Shoulder Room, Row 2 52.4 in 56.8 in -4.4 in
Hip Room, Row 2 51.0 in 56.7 in -5.7 in
Legroom, Row 2 34.6 in 37.2 in -2.6 in
Total Legroom 76.8 in (over 2 rows) 78.2 in (over 2 rows) -1.4 in
Cargo Volume, Minimum 12.0 ft3 46.4 ft3 -34.4 ft3
Cargo Volume, Maximum 12.0 ft3 82.0 ft3 -70 ft3
